This manual contains important information for the correct installation, operation and maintenance of the equipment
described herein. All persons involved in such installation, operation, and maintenance should be thoroughly familiar
with the contents. To safeguard against the possibility of personal injury or property damage, follow the recommenda-
tions and instructions of this manual and keep it for further reference.
The equipment shown in this manual is intended for industrial use only and should not be used to lift, support, or other-
wise transport people.
